Convert each mixed number to an improper fraction
--------------------------------------------
Convert 6&1/2 to an improper fraction
6&1/2 = (6*2+1)/2
6&1/2 = (12+1)/2
6&1/2 = 13/2
--------------------------------------------
Do the same for 9&1/4
9&1/4 = (9*4+1)/4
9&1/4 = (36+1)/4
9&1/4 = 37/4
--------------------------------------------
Now multiply the improper fractions 13/2 and 37/4. Multiply straight across
(13/2)*(37/4) = (13*37)/(2*4)
(13/2)*(37/4) = 481/8
--------------------------------------------
The last step is to use long division to find the mixed number equivalent of 481/8
Or we an say
60*8 = 480
So 60*8+1 = 480+1
which means
481/8 = (480+1)/8 = 480/8+1/8 = 60&1/8
